When it comes to building scale models, attention to detail is key in creating a realistic and visually stunning final product. One popular technique that model builders use to add intricate details to their projects is photoetch.
photoetch, also known as photo etching or photochemical machining, is a process of creating detailed and precise parts for scale models by chemically etching metal sheets. This technique allows modelers to replicate fine details that are difficult or impossible to achieve through traditional modeling methods.
One of the main advantages of using photoetch in scale modeling is the level of detail that can be achieved. With photoetch, modelers can create parts with sharp and precise features such as rivets, panel lines, grilles, and other small details that bring a scale model to life. These intricate details can greatly enhance the realism and overall look of a model, making it stand out on display.
Another benefit of using photoetch is the versatility it offers. photoetch can be used on a wide range of scale models, including military vehicles, aircraft, cars, ships, and more. Whether you’re building a World War II tank or a modern fighter jet, photoetch can help take your model to the next level by adding authentic details that make it look like the real thing.
photoetch parts come in a variety of shapes and sizes, making them suitable for different applications in scale modeling. From small brackets and latches to larger components like engine grilles and gun barrels, photoetch parts can be used to enhance the appearance and accuracy of a model in various ways.
While photoetch parts offer great detail and versatility, they do require some skill and patience to work with. Photoetch sheets are typically made of thin brass or stainless steel, which can be delicate and prone to bending or breaking if mishandled. Modelers need to use specialized tools such as tweezers, scissors, and bending tools to cut, shape, and assemble photoetch parts with precision.
To work with photoetch effectively, modelers also need to have a basic understanding of the photoetching process itself. The process involves applying a light-sensitive photoresist coating to a metal sheet, exposing it to a UV light source through a photographic negative of the desired part, and developing and etching the metal to reveal the final shape. While this process is usually done by manufacturers to create commercial photoetch parts, some modelers also experiment with DIY photoetching at home to create custom parts for their projects.
